Lower Grand Lagoon Rent by Property Type & Bedroom Count

Property Type Bedrooms Average Median Min - Max 25th - 75th
Apartment 1 Bedroom $1,709 $1,350 $1,100 - $2,800 $1,195 - $2,100
Apartment 2 Bedroom $1,425 $1,375 $1,300 - $1,650 $1,350 - $1,650
Apartment 3 Bedroom $2,748 $2,547 $2,200 - $3,700 $2,295 - $3,700
House 2 Bedroom $1,834 $1,750 $1,600 - $2,350 $1,695 - $1,775
House 3 Bedroom $2,547 $2,550 $1,600 - $3,500 $2,200 - $3,000
House 4+ Bedroom $2,861 $3,050 $1,895 - $3,450 $2,900 - $3,450

In the current period, the average rent in Lower Grand Lagoon was $1,709 for 1 Bedroom, $1,652 for 2 Bedroom, $2,581 for 3 Bedroom, and $2,861 for 4+ Bedroom.
Note: This analysis includes only bedroom types with sufficient data.
